Specifications of Samsung Galaxy A30

To understand how well the Galaxy A30 performs in gaming scenarios, we first need to analyze its core specifications:

Specification Details
Display 6.4 inches Super AMOLED, 1080 x 2340 pixels
Processor Exynos 7904 Octa-core
RAM 4GB / 6GB
Storage 64GB / 128GB, expandable up to 512GB via microSD
Battery 4000 mAh with fast charging
Operating System Android 9.0 (upgradable)
Graphics Mali-G71 MP2

Performance and Processor

The Exynos 7904 chipset, coupled with up to 6GB of RAM, provides a decent performance for most casual games. This octa-core processor can handle gaming titles that aren’t overly demanding, such as:

  • Angry Birds
  • Among Us
  • Call of Duty: Mobile at low to medium settings

However, it’s important to note that more graphically intense games like PUBG Mobile or Fortnite may lead to a lagging experience if played on high settings. Lowering the graphics settings can help mitigate this and allow for smoother gameplay, but the overall experience may not be as thrilling as on more advanced devices.

Graphics Capabilities

The Mali-G71 MP2 GPU is fairly capable for a mid-range smartphone, allowing users to enjoy many popular games with reasonable frame rates. That said, gaming graphics are not its strongest suit. The A30 does well with games that have stylized graphics or less intensive visual requirements.

Battery Life

With a 4000 mAh battery, the Galaxy A30 is equipped to handle prolonged gaming sessions without constantly needing a recharge. Many users have reported that during casual gaming, the device can last an entire day with normal usage, though this can vary based on game intensity and graphics settings. Moreover, the fast charging feature ensures that you’ll spend less time plugged in, so it’s less likely to interrupt your gaming sessions.

Software Experience

The Samsung A30 runs on Android 9.0 and comes with Samsung’s One UI, which enhances the overall user experience. The software allows for customization and can improve multitasking, providing a smoother gaming interface.

Game Launcher

Samsung’s built-in Game Launcher is another boon for gamers using the A30. It consolidates your games in one place and offers various features:

  • Game Tools: Allows for screen recording, blocking notifications, and enabling ‘Do Not Disturb’ mode while gaming.
  • Performance Management: Users can select performance modes tailored for gaming, helping to enhance performance during more intensive sessions.

Thermal Management

Overheating is a common concern during extended gaming sessions. The Galaxy A30, despite its mid-range status, has shown decent heat management capabilities. Users generally haven’t reported significantly overheating issues, although playing demanding games for extended periods may result in warmth. Compatibility with Popular Games

The Samsung A30 can run many popular titles available in app stores, yet the gameplay experience varies across different games. Let’s assess its compatibility with some of the renowned gaming apps:

Casual Games

Casual games perform notably well on the A30. Titles such as:

  • Candy Crush Saga
  • Clash of Clans

These types of games rely less on hardware and thus provide a smooth, lag-free experience.

Mid-Range Games

Games such as PUBG Mobile or Call of Duty: Mobile can also be played on the A30. While it may not perform optimally on high settings, users can experience reasonable gameplay on medium to low settings.

High-End Games

Playing demanding high-end games like Genshin Impact or Fortnite often leads to performance issues on the A30. Users may encounter lag, frame drops, and prolonged loading times, particularly during graphics-heavy scenes.
